In the realm of sustainable fashion, organic cotton has been gaining popularity due to its environmental benefits. As people become more conscious about their choices and their impact on the planet, organic cotton swimwear is emerging as a stylish and eco-friendly option for beachgoers. This natural fiber is cultivated without harmful pesticides or synthetic fertilizers, ensuring that it is free from toxic chemicals that can harm both the environment and our skin.
One of the main advantages of choosing organic cotton swimwear is its reduced impact on water resources. Traditional cotton production requires vast amounts of water, which often leads to over-extraction from local rivers and lakes. In contrast, organic cotton cultivation relies on rainwater for irrigation purposes, minimizing water waste and preserving precious freshwater sources.
Additionally, organic farming practices promote biodiversity by avoiding the use of genetically modified seeds. Instead, farmers rely on traditional seed varieties that are better adapted to local conditions and have a higher resistance to pests and diseases. By preserving genetic diversity in crops, organic cotton production helps maintain ecosystems’ resilience while promoting long-term sustainability.

When purchasing organic cotton swimwear items for your next vacation or poolside adventure, make sure they are certified by recognized organizations such as G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or OCS (Organic Content Standard). These certifications ensure that the garments you choose meet strict organic standards throughout the production chain, from cultivation to manufacturing.
